Description The Mechanicsburg PA office is looking for Bridge Design Engineers with interest and experience in Complex and Long Span Fixed Bridge Design to join their National Bridge Group. What We’re Looking For 4+ years related Bridge Design Experience At minimum a BS in Civil Engineering from an ABET accredited College or University MS in Civil Engineering is preferred Ideal candidates will be within 6 months of obtaining a valid PE Possesses specialized knowledge in one or more areas of bridge analysis and design (for example: concrete analysis, time dependent post-tensioned concrete, seismic, foundations, etc.). What You’ll Do: Identify complex problems, evaluate options, and suggest/implement solutions. Effectively manage time and resources in the execution of their duties and responsibilities. Mentor entry level engineers Use computer assisted design and drafting software. Use more advanced engineering analysis software. Design, detail and create contract plan sheets for bridge related projects. Establish and maintain effective working relationships with co-workers, Project Managers, administrative supervisor, other team members, clients and subcontractors. Receive and convey ideas and information effectively, both orally and in writing, with co-workers, Project Managers, administrative supervisor, other team members, clients, and subcontractors Produce project related internal and external correspondence. Who we are: National Bridge Group focuses on complex and long span fixed bridge design, as well as housing our research expertise and specification development efforts. Projects include new design and rehabilitation of complex and long span bridges such as arches, post-tensioned concrete structures, cable stayed bridges, suspension bridges, and all other structure types. M&M’s forensic and collapse investigation expertise, as well as seismic and erection engineering, is also housed in this unit. The staff of this unit is composed mainly of Structural Engineers, typically with advanced degrees. For more information on recent Research and Specification Development, click here The Company: M&M is one of the world’s Leading Bridge Engineering Firms, with a reputation for technical excellence and innovation that goes beyond current standards. Established more than 130 years ago, our firm is responsible for the design and maintenance of some of our nation’s most recognizable structures. Services include fixed and movable bridge design, inspection and rehabilitation, and all facets of life-cycle maintenance, research, and code development.
